4 Key Chelsea players set for Saudi Exodus

  • N’Golo Kante, Edouard Mendy, Koulibaly, and Ziyech are some of Chelsea’s players set to join Saudi leagues.

Chelsea are set to lose four players to Saudi-based clubs this summer as the Blues begin a summer clearout.

Midfielder N’Golo Kante is close to agreeing a deal to join Al Ittihad after seven years at Chelsea. The 32-year-old Frenchman is a free agent at the end of June, and is keen to seek a new challenge after winning the Premier League, Champions League, Europa League, and FIFA Club World Cup with the Blues.

Kante is a world-class midfielder known for his energy, tackling ability, and passing range. He would be a major asset to any team, and Al Ittihad are reportedly offering him a lucrative contract.

Goalkeeper Edouard Mendy is also set to leave Chelsea this summer. The 31-year-old Senegalese international lost his place to Kepa Arrizabalaga last season, and is now surplus to requirements at Stamford Bridge.

Mendy is a talented goalkeeper who was a key part of Chelsea’s Champions League victory in 2021. However, he has struggled to maintain his form in recent months, and Al Ahli are reportedly offering him a chance to revive his career.

Defender Kalidou Koulibaly is also being targeted by Saudi-based clubs. The 30-year-old Senegalese international has been a key player for Chelsea since joining the club in 2018.

However, he has been linked with a move away from Stamford Bridge in recent months, and Al Hilal are reportedly interested in signing him.

Koulibaly is a strong, physical defender who is known for his aerial ability. He would be a major asset to any team, and Al Hilal are reportedly offering him a lucrative contract.

Winger Hakim Ziyech is close to an agreement with Cristiano Ronaldo’s club Al Nassr. The 29-year-old Moroccan international has struggled to find his form at Chelsea since joining the club in 2020.

He was on the verge of joining Paris Saint-Germain in January, but the move fell through due to paperwork issues.

Ziyech is a talented winger who is known for his dribbling ability and creativity. He would be a major asset to any team, and Al Nassr are reportedly offering him a chance to revive his career.

The sale of these four players would generate significant revenue for Chelsea, who are looking to raise funds after being sanctioned by the UK government.

The Blues are also expected to sell other players this summer as they look to rebuild their squad under new manager Mauricio Pochettino.
